      <description>&lt;P&gt;I would put this more that your information does not match what the system reports.&amp;nbsp; What is on the server is on the server.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;How are you accessing your emails?&amp;nbsp; Not all email applications are good at subscribing to all of the folders which are there.&amp;nbsp; Some email applications do their own thing, this can be particularly confusing if you access the same mailbox from different devices running different software all using IMAP.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;For example, many email clients will recognise an existing folder as being for sent items (by various names) but Win10 Mail insists on doing its own thing ... and you can end up with more than one "sent" folder.&amp;nbsp; Anti-virus software / mail scanners / mail washers also create quarantine folders - which may or may not be visible in your email application.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;For example on iPhones, sub-folders are not visible unless you access the mailbox by the second entry further down the mailbox list.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;The best way to see what is in your mailbox is to access it via webmail - click the cog at the bottom left and select manage folders.&amp;nbsp; If the folder is not ticked, it will not appear in the webmail mail messages panel.&amp;nbsp; Similarly with something like Outlook365, you need to ensure that the email client has subscribed to all folders.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>Indeed. Folders are not hidden as such. Each IMAP email client makes choices about which folders it subscribes to by default … and then users presume that those are the only folders on the server.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;In the case of Apple (iPhone), in the mail account advanced settings, you can choose which server folder is used for Sent, Draft and Trash items.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;There is much to be gained using webmail to look for folders not subscribed to by other IMAP clients. Misuse of email as a file transfer service can gobble up a great deal of file server storage to say nothing of mobile phone bandwidth … especially if the photo is sent to one’s self … as my best mate does all the time. He too wonders why he keeps getting the FUP warnings!!&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;I will take a look at Squirrel (basic) webmail and see if that has folder subscription options as it tends to be faster. There is a lot to like about the basic webmail notably it’s ability to colour code mail items depending upon user defined rules.</description>
